建站小白必看:网站建设的数据导入导出到底怎么搞才不踩坑?

本文关键词:网站建设的数据导入导出

干了七年建站,我见过太多老板在数据迁移上栽跟头。前阵子有个做服装的朋友,非说之前那家服务商把库存搞丢了,急得差点报警。其实哪有什么丢数据,纯粹是操作太野,格式对不上,数据库直接报错。今天我就掏心窝子聊聊网站建设的数据导入导出那些事儿,别整那些虚头巴脑的理论,直接上干货。

首先得明白,数据导入导出不是简单的复制粘贴。很多新手以为把Excel表格拖进后台就行,结果发现标题乱码、图片裂开、价格小数点错位。我上次帮一个客户做网站改版,他给了个几万条商品的Excel表,打开一看,好家伙,日期格式五花八门,有的用斜杠,有的用横杠,还有的单元格合并了。这种数据直接导入,后台绝对炸锅。所以第一步,清洗数据。你得把格式统一,比如日期全改成YYYY-MM-DD,价格去掉货币符号,只留数字。这一步虽然繁琐,但能省后面至少三天的调试时间。

再说说导出。很多人觉得导出就是点一下按钮,完事。大错特错。如果你网站有几万条文章,直接导出可能会超时,或者导出的CSV文件里包含大量HTML标签,导致导入新系统时解析失败。这时候得用分页导出,或者分批处理。我有个做B2B机械设备的客户,导出产品参数时,因为字段太多,默认导出只取了前10个字段,导致关键规格全丢了。后来我让他写个自定义SQL查询,把需要的字段单独拉出来,再转成CSV,这才搞定。

关于网站建设的数据导入导出,还有一个坑就是图片链接。很多系统导出时,图片路径是相对路径,换服务器后直接失效。解决办法是,在导出前,先用插件把所有图片链接改成绝对路径,或者单独打包图片文件夹,上传到新服务器后,再批量替换数据库里的路径。别嫌麻烦,这一步不做,网站上线就是满屏404。

我见过最惨的案例,是一个做二手车的网站,老板为了省几百块迁移费,自己瞎搞。结果把数据库结构搞乱了,导入新系统后,车辆状态全变成“未知”,买家根本没法筛选。最后只能花大价钱请我救火。所以,别为了省小钱吃大亏。如果数据量超过一万条,建议还是找专业的人做,或者至少找个懂点技术的同事帮忙把关。

另外,备份!备份!备份!重要的事情说三遍。在导入新数据前,一定要把旧系统的数据完整备份。哪怕你觉得自己操作万无一失,意外也总在你最放松的时候发生。我习惯在本地存一份,再存一份云盘,双重保险。

最后,测试环节不能省。导入完成后,别急着上线。先随机抽100条数据,检查标题、内容、图片、链接是否正常。特别是移动端适配,很多PC端正常的页面,在手机上可能因为图片过大而变形。我一般会用手机真机测试,而不是只用模拟器,因为模拟器的渲染引擎和真机还是有差别的。

总之,网站建设的数据导入导出看似简单,实则细节满满。每一个字段、每一个链接、每一个格式,都可能成为绊脚石。希望我的这些经验能帮你避开那些坑,让你的网站迁移顺顺利利。别等出了问题再后悔,提前规划,仔细操作,才是正道。